Overview:

The role of Head of Computational Drug Design has a high-level responsibility to drive a “predict-first” culture, where computational predictions drive experimental execution in chemistry, biology and protein sciences, ultimately initiating selection of the best molecules to treat transformative diseases and the understanding of its biological interactions.

About the position:

In addition to providing scientific and technical leadership you will provide thought leadership to deliver and maintain a world class, global drug design team that drives innovation and leads scientists to rapidly generate testable hypotheses to identify and advance safe and efficacious molecules with fewer and shorter cycle times.

Eligibility Criteria:

  • PhD degree or equivalent in a STEM discipline or other relevant field and 12+yrs of relevant experience
  • Recognized subject matter expert in Computational Drug Design
  • Ability to inspire and improve the performance of a global department
  • Demonstrate effective interpersonal, communications and negotiation skills for a wide variety of audiences, including senior management.
